JOB DESCRIPTION

 

Position Title:Middle School English Language Arts Teacher

Reports to: Chief Executive Officer and Principal

Term: Ten (10) month position, salaried

POSITION SUMMARY AND RESPONSIBILITIES

GLA educators are fired up about teaching and learning. They want to spend their time immersing themselves in the rich content that they teach. They believe in the power of family and community partnerships and want to nurture the gifts that our children inherently possess. GLA schools value educators who truly listen to what scholars are saying—who encourage children to take intellectual risks, and who praise their insights and curiosities along the way. Successful GLA educators have a spirit of continual improvement, a hunger for feedback and professional growth, and a dedication to excellence.

English Language Arts teachers at GLA build thinking classrooms. Scholars are encouraged to be curious and ask questions for clarification when they need to better understand something, understand conceptual understandings, and solve authentic, real-world problems to promote critical thinking.

 

The Middle School English Language Arts Teacher will be responsible for the successful completion of the following tasks:

· Designing rigorous, PA Core standards-aligned lessons based on the standards for English Language Arts practice and content

· Plan for class activities, including preparing units and daily lesson plans, identifying materials to implement class activities, preparing class projects, giving children feedback on completed work to ensure mastery of presented material, and grading of tests and assignments in a timely manner.

· Establishing and communicating clear objectives for lessons, units and projects

· Maintaining positive relationships with scholars, parents, coworkers and supervisors

· Creating a safe, respectful and inclusive classroom environment

· Working with scholars in both small groups and large groups

· Tracking and evaluating student academic progress

· Attend professional meetings, educational conferences, and teacher training workshops in order to maintain and improve professional competence

· Identify the educational needs of scholars and altering instruction to meet student needs

· Communicate with parents on a regular basis about schedule, assignments, events, and individual scholar needs. Meet with parents during scheduled conferences during the school year.

**Other duties as assigned by CEO, Principal, or Academy Leader**

 

QUALIFICATIONS
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ty exceptionally.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and/or ability required.


E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E

Bachelor’s degree from four-year college or university required in field of education


CERTIFICATES AND/OR LICENSES
It is preferred that the Middle School English Language Arts teacher have a current teaching license (Grades 4-8 English)


PROFESSIONAL DEMEANOR AND CHARACTERISTICS
Ability to demonstrate initiative, leadership, collaboration, and independent thinking. Must possess strong people skills and emotional intelligence when dealing with students, parents, and colleagues, as well as a demonstrated understanding of and investment in the School.


COMPENSATION
Initial salary offers for this position range from $50,000 – $75,000. Salaries are determined using an equitable compensation scale that accounts for years of experience and levels of attained education. This role is eligible for up to $5,000 in sign-on bonuses.
